I'm trying to understand why a number of client computers are sending UDP 500 traffic to strange places. For example, 
from one machine it is sending traffic to 209.85.225.166 which is owned by Google. Netstat tells me that the traffic 
is originating from SVCHOST.

I thought UDP 500 was used for IKE but is it also used for some sort of keep alive? I'm confused!
